Works fine, but 2 major issues August 1, 2010 Peter Alvarez This set of Panasonic cordless phones work fine. the sound quality is clear, buttons are easy to press, back-lit keys, voice caller-id, good talk time with a full charge, compact size. The two major problems I have with this series are:
1. Phone book limited to 50 entries. I fail to understand why, in today's day and age, the phonebook would be limited to only 50 entries. This is a major inconvenience.
2. The previous set that we had allowed you to transfer phonebook entries or the entire phone book from one handset to another. This was a convenient feature that saved time having to enter the phone book all over again in each handset. This particular model does NOT come with this feature! This is a very subtle issue that can be easily overlooked. I find it to be a major annoyance.
